Cheer Holding, Inc. is a diversified holding company primarily operating in the Chinese market, with core business segments covering early childhood education services, mobile lifestyle platforms, digital content offerings, and integrated consumer solutions for households and enterprise partners across multiple demand scenarios.

Rainier Bancorporation was the Seattle-based parent corporation of Rainier National Bank, a Washington state bank with branches throughout the state. Rainier traced its roots back to the National Bank of Commerce, which was founded by Richard Holyoke in 1889. The name Rainier National Bank was adopted in 1974.
